Cyber threat simulation is one of the resources that have been deployed to help deal with cyber-attacks. A cyber threat simulation is an approach where a real life attack is imitated and used to test how a firm using cyber infrastructures can respond to the threat (Montana and UcedaVelez 579). A threat is created where there exist two groups in one company the group bringing in the threat to the company and the group responsible for finding a solution to fight the threat. Simulations help to measure the speed of a real attack and how long it takes the company to respond to the threat.

According to the U.S. Department of Homeland Security in the article Cyber Threats to Mobile Phones, phones are now sharing hardware and software similar to a PC and becoming each time more like a PC. Therefore, the risks of being hacked are increasing, allowing hackers to attack mobile devices the same way as if they were doing it with a regular PC. Personal and professional information are more often stored on mobile devices therefore it is imperative to have our data secure. Security solutions for mobile devices are not as broad or high-tech as those for PCs. The majority of mobile security relies on the proper use and smart choices that the user makes on a daily basis to be protected against cyber attacks. Even the most careful person can be attacked but the possibilities of that happening are less when you are proactive.
